donovan6000 commented 8 years ago

People were complaining about having to flash the firmware everytime they switched between using M3D Fio and the official software due to the version number I used in the last 315°C firmware, so I M3D Fio now includes both unmodified and modified versions of the firmware.

The M3D Mod firmwares have the temperatures increased, so M3D Mod V2016040401 is what your looking for. mod
